CILICIA, Corycus. Antiochos IV of Comagene. 38-72 AD. Æ 15mm (3.13g, 3h). Dated RY 4 (41/2 AD). King on galloping horse left, his arm extended; below,
D (date) / Apollo standing half left, holding branch. SNG Levante 805 (this coin); SNG France -. Good VF, green and brown patina.
